Title:
METHOD FOR ISOLATING TRANSITION METAL AND LI FROM COMPOUND INCLUDING LI AND TRANSITION METAL

Abstract:
The disclosed method for isolating a transition metal and Li comprises a step in which a compound including Li and the transition metal is reacted with a carboxylic acid in water to obtain a slurry comprising both a first solution, which contains Li ions, and a precipitate including a transition metal carboxylate and a step in which the precipitate is separated from the first solution, the transition metal being at least one metal selected from the group consisting of Ni, Co, Mn, Ti, Fe, and Cu.
